Thoughts:
1. Stay calm.
2. Do the right thing.
Marcus's simple rubric for how to make decisions. (Meditations, 8.5)
Think about the situation. Strip away my biases and preconceptions. Distance myself from the emotive aspects and try to see just the facts. By evaluating things calmly and rationally, I give myself the best chance to judge things as they are rather than as I fear, or wish, them to be. Accuracy counts more than speed. Get it right through patience and clarity.
Focus on virtue. Weigh the moral costs first and, all other things being equal, then consider practical effects. Preserving and improving my character trumps all else. Helping others follows. Kindness counts. Matters of taste and preference and practicality fall last.
